Title: **Innovative Contributions of David J. Sharpe in Chemiluminescent Technology**
Introduction
David J. Sharpe, based in Foxboro, Massachusetts, is a distinguished inventor renowned for his significant contributions to the field of chemiluminescent technology. With an impressive portfolio comprising 20 patents, Sharpe has made substantial advancements that enhance the performance and applicability of acridinium esters in various fields.
Latest Patents
Among his latest innovations, Sharpe has developed hydrophilic high quantum yield acridinium esters that exhibit improved stability and rapid light emission. These novel compounds are designed to enhance light output, minimize nonspecific binding, and increase overall efficiency. The essential features of Sharpe's chemiluminescent acridinium esters include hydrophilic, branched, electron-donating functional groups strategically positioned at the C2 and/or C7 locations of the acridinium nucleus, providing remarkable advancements in chemiluminescent applications.
